Abstract:Based on the HHT (Hilbert-Huang Transform), the ChebyshevⅠtype filter was adopted to process the measured free vibration signal to solve the mode-mixing problem, so that all the structural modes could be acquired from IMFs. Meanwhile, removing endpoints were used during the linear least-square fit procedure to avoid the endpoint effect. Besides obtaining the modal frequencies and damping ratios, the formulation of mode shapes of proportional-damping structure was also derived. The simulation results of 4-NDOF numerical case and 4-NDOF frame structure in the laboratory have demonstrated that the proposed approach is accurate and effective.
